Dy₂Mg₁Al₁ is an intermetallic compound combining dysprosium (a rare-earth element), magnesium, and aluminum. This material belongs to the rare-earth intermetallic family and is primarily of research interest rather than established industrial production; it is studied for potential applications where rare-earth elements provide magnetic, thermal, or electronic functionality combined with the lightweight benefits of magnesium and aluminum matrices. The material's notable characteristics stem from dysprosium's strong magnetocrystalline anisotropy and the relatively low density of the Mg-Al base, making it a candidate for advanced magnetic alloys, high-temperature applications, or specialized functional materials where rare-earth performance justifies material cost.
